Saddleworth is a locality 95 km from Adelaide in South Australia, classified as outer regional by the ABS. The postcode is 5413. It falls within the Barossa - Yorke - Mid North region. The local government area is Clare and Gilbert Valleys.

According to the 2021 Census, Saddleworth has a population of 483 with a median age of 55. The median weekly household income is $894, below the SA average. The unemployment rate is 4.8%, lower than the SA average. The Indigenous population is 16 (3.3% of residents).

Housing in Saddleworth includes a median weekly rent of $207, median monthly mortgage repayment of $789, with 217 total dwellings. Housing costs in the area sit below the SA average. Owner-occupied dwellings (owned or mortgaged) make up 80.6% of housing.

On the SEIFA Index of Relative Socio-economic Advantage and Disadvantage, Saddleworth scores in decile 1 out of 10, which is well below the national average.

Saddleworth is served by Saddleworth Primary School.
